Now, you should be at your Grafana's web GUI, and https is configured! HTTPS is okay I implemented it successfully. follow this steps. It can be even better if it has native Windows cert store integration, so you wont need export certs/keys to pem files. Enable certificate options and define the paths to the certificate and key file! The simplest Grafana container creation looks like this: Youll have a fresh Grafana server accessible on port 3000. document.getElementById( "ak_js_1" ).setAttribute( "value", ( new Date() ).getTime() ); This site uses Akismet to reduce spam.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. And for LDAPS need Lnux version of Gafana under Linux and little system modification to implement LDAPS? I exported CA certificate from the Grafana Windows Server machine from his local certificate store from trusted certificate folder. allowed ciphers, cipher order preference, TLS versions, because thats not customizable in the Grafana. I tried to skip client certificates. ), How to tell which packages are held back due to phased updates. Also remember to customize the name Read [Upgrading Grafana]({{< relref installation/upgrading.md >}}) for tips and guidance on updating an existing How to configure https for Grafana on Windows Server 2022? This also helps version changes to your installation over time. Thank you in advance for your feedback. CN Paste the directory path like below command: Now Prometheus is successfully installed in your machine. Select " Windows " on the list of available operating systems, and click on " Download the Installer ". Making statements based on opinion; back them up with references or personal experience. Visualization with the use of charts and graphs. Grafana is a free and open source visualization tool mostly used with Prometheus to which monitor metrics. The Docker image includes a helper utility that lets you add plugins to a new container by setting a special environment variable. You can mount a replacement to the expected path using a Docker bind mount: Using a config file eases the injection of more complicated settings. Powered by Discourse, best viewed with JavaScript enabled, Grafana Windows Version how to implement HTTPS and ldaps LDAPS, grafana/grafana/blob/1b149523edc2f9add9dc4f816e4895b827db1b83/conf/defaults.ini#L29-L64, grafana/grafana/blob/1b149523edc2f9add9dc4f816e4895b827db1b83/conf/ldap.toml#L11, Hyper-V Dojo - Altaro's Microsoft Hyper-V blog 23 May 19, How to Request SSL Certificates from a Windows Certificate Server, #################################### Server ##############################, # The ip address to bind to, empty will bind to all interfaces, # The public facing domain name used to access grafana from a browser, # Redirect to correct domain if host header does not match domain, root_url = %(protocol)s://%(domain)s:%(http_port)s/, # To troubleshoot and get more log info enable ldap debug logging in grafana.ini, # Ldap server host (specify multiple hosts space separated), # Default port is 389 or 636 if use_ssl = true, # Set to true if LDAP server should use an encrypted TLS connection (either with STARTTLS or LDAPS), # If set to true, use LDAP with STARTTLS instead of LDAPS, # set to true if you want to skip ssl cert validation, # set to the path to your root CA certificate or leave unset to use system defaults, # root_ca_cert = "/path/to/certificate.crt", # Authentication against LDAP servers requiring client certificates. The following instructions will work with both of these top-level variants. On the Windows platform, we can install Grafana either through a Standalone library file or a Windows installer package. Is it correct to use "the" before "materials used in making buildings are"? Please spend a minute and learn how to format code in your posts (its simple markdown). on How to install Grafana on Windows and Windows Server, Fresh Start, Clean Install and PC Reset: How to perform a Fresh Start installation of Windows 10, How to Enhance Multi-monitor Experience using Built-in Features on Windows 11, Unable to connect via RDP after installing Norton 360 on Windows, Ways to Run PowerShell remotely on Azure VMs, Follow WordPress.com News on WordPress.com. Install with Windows installer (recommended) Click Download the installer. Step1 - Download & Install Grafana for windows Step 2 - Open Grafana in Browser Step 3 - Add Data Source Step 4 - Create a Dashboard Step 5 - Add graph 03 Real Time Monitoring : Set up Grafana with InfluxDB Installing Grafana is quite easy. Acidity of alcohols and basicity of amines. In the next window, simply insert the dashboard ID in the corresponding text field. If it does not appear in the default port, you can try changing to a different port. You can use Grafana Cloud to avoid installing, maintaining, and scaling your own instance of Grafana. The error message was the following: "The service did not return an error. title = Installing on Windows This page lists the minimum hardware and software requirements to install Grafana. You can change any of the keys in Grafanas INI-format config files by capitalizing the key name and prepending GF_: Make sure you include the implicit DEFAULT section name when youre changing the value of a top-level variable in the config file. Grafana uses a dual-license business model. We made a basic design to understand it easily for you people. The solution to this question will hopefully give a direct solution for any who search for a https solution on a Grafana Windows installation. PromQL allows the user to select and aggregate the data. Hello all, I am faced with issues with LDAPS and HTTPS. Note: PostgreSQL versions 10.9, 11.4, and 12-beta2 are affected by a bug (tracked by the PostgreSQL project as bug #15865) which prevents those versions from being used with Grafana. Configure. Resolving javax.net.ssl.SSLHandshakeException: sun.security.validator.ValidatorException: PKIX path building failed Error? 5 Transfer it to the Grafana server! 1. I hope this self-answered question solves your question in one read. We can also create our own dynamic dashboard for visualization and monitoring. You can also change the port number to the one you need. Click Download the zip file. Install and Use Grafana 8 on Windows 11 / Windows 10 Windows Server Monitoring using Prometheus and WMI Exporter - devconnected 1 Generate CSR under Lnux OS using Open SSL and transfer private key to the Grafana server. How to manually install the grafana-clock plugin This page lists the minimum hardware and software requirements to install Grafana. To run Grafana, you must have a supported operating system, hardware that meets or exceeds minimum requirements, a supported database, and a supported browser. Save my name, email, and website in this browser for the next time I comment. I tried but I receives errors, I am sure I dont use the right format of the certificates. Could you tell me more about certificates? Grafana Tutorial | A Beginners Guide to Grafana | Mindmajix configuration option and change it to something like 8080 or similar. In Linux this job could be done with an apache2 server as a proxy server? Avoid downtime. If the problem persists, contact your system administrator.". Store it wherever you want, in my case it will be in the Program Files folder. If the server is joined to the Domain controller, the server receive his root ca certificate, and his own server certificate is automatically signed by the Ca server during joining to the domain. Create a free account to get started, which includes free forever access to 10k metrics, 50GB logs, 50GB traces, & more. Just ignore configuration regarding certificates with #. You can in the future copy the content of either the origininal.custom.ini, https.custom.ini or any other file you may have made into the custom.ini file. Go to your browser and go to, Open OpenSSL by searching for it in Windows' search field. 3 Add users in the GrafanaUserGroup! http://localhost:9090/targets. Additional helpful documentation, links, and articles: Opening keynote: What's new in Grafana 9? When you are done, simply execute the MSI installer. Virtual Machine, Windows Server 2022 version 10.0.20348. Install standalone Windows binary Click Download the zip file . So we will use 14510 to import Grafana.com, Lets come to Grafana Home page and you can see a + icon. These parameters are minimum! With the help of Service discovery the services are identified which need to be scraped. We select and review products independently. original.custom.ini. How to install Grafana on Windows and Windows Server - Learn [Solve IT] There you are done with the setup. He has experience managing complete end-to-end web development workflows, using technologies including Linux, GitLab, Docker, and Kubernetes. I will follow up this question with the solution that worked for me. Copy the original.sample.ini file and rename the copy to original.sample.ini file. Unblock in Microsoft Firewall port 443! Failed to load LDAP config file: Near line 21 (last key parsed servers.root_ca_cert): invalid escape character P; only the following escape characters are allowed: \b, \t, \n, \f, \r, \, \, \uXXXX, and \UXXXXXXXX" remote_addr=192.168.0.20" The solution is: Moving the exported CA certificate to other Linux host and to convert it to pem format using OpenSSL but doesnt help. Grafana Labs uses cookies for the normal operation of this website. There are several data sources that can be used with Grafana but I will use InfluxDB at this time. Join 425,000 subscribers and get a daily digest of news, geek trivia, and our feature articles. And exactly how did you do? This question is raised, as when I searched the web for answers - I did not find a direct answer and had to gather parts from different solutions I had read up to that point, from different resources that appeared in the Google searches I had made. Execute the installer and continue with the installation process. Navigate to you downloaded file and click to install the file. I want to tell you that I successfully implement HTTPS and LDAPS! This website is using a security service to protect itself from online attacks. GrafanaEnterprise version 9.2.4.0, standard Windows installer from: Step 3 - Create selfsigned .crt and .key files as .pem files with In the end I change the file form pem to crt. Is there a proper earth ground point in this switch box? You are not creating ldaps, you are connecting to existing ldaps - generally to some tls endpoint, so you need only ca certs usually on the client(Grafana) side. Check that your files are created with this command. Copy the sample.ini file and rename the copy to FQDN Then do not forget to input the default URL for InfluxDB which is http://localhost:8086. Grafana with https - Cannot find SSL cert_file, Unable to run Grafana server on local system, Grafana for K8S - configure dashboard access permissions, db query error: failed to connect to server - please inspect Grafana server log for details, Cannot access Grafana (Docker image) using port 3000 from non-local server, Linux Docker Container on Windows Server 2022. this folder to anywhere you want Grafana to run from. We also get your email address to automatically create an account for you in our website. Download Grafana. Now when you launch Grafana, Cloudflare for Grafana will appear on the home screen under installed apps. grafana/developer-guide.md at main grafana/grafana GitHub Multiple Grafana versions are available, each in either Alpine or Ubuntu flavors. I want to use a signed certificate for the HTTPS from Microsoft Ca server is it possible to do it? Now provide the name and select the Prometheus Datasource and click on Import. As per your requirement you can do other changes or you can also keep remaining configuration as default. Scroll until you see Windows Binaries (64-bit). 3 Transfer it signed to Linus OS and with Open SSL convert it in PEM! A Docker volume called grafana-data is referenced by the -v flag. 4 In ldap config of grafana change port to 636! See the links above for the support policies for each project. Now lets build a dashboard in Grafana so then it will able to reflect the metrics of the Windows system. Once its and up and running, a Dockerized Grafana installation works just like a regular one. I did not know of whether posting the solution as an answer to a self-raised question, or to make an article on it. This means you can include version expressions, such as grafana-simple-json-datasource 1.1.0, and reference community plugins via their URL: Manually bringing up Grafana containers with configuration supplied via docker run flags is repetitive and error-prone. Connect Grafana to data sources, apps, and more, with Grafana Alerting, Grafana Incident, and Grafana OnCall, Frontend application observability web SDK, Try out and share prebuilt visualizations, Contribute to technical documentation provided by Grafana Labs, Help build the future of open source observability software I tried creating self-signed certificates with openssl, "grafana.key" and "grafana.crt", this worked, but when referencing them in Grafana's configuration file "custom.ini" the following error occurred. And the Grafana server is installed in Microsoft Windows Server 2019. You can change it in the Grafana UI later. The Download URL from Grafana.com API is in this form: https://grafana.com/api/plugins/<plugin id>/versions/<version number>/download I tried and export from Windows server machine, Offer is available only for limited time, so enroll quickly.Apache NiFi - Beginners to Advance Guide: https://itpanther.com/apachenifiApache NiFi - Admin Guide - Know Clustering and Other Advance Topics: https://itpanther.com/apachenifiadminLiferay - Create Your Website Without The Need to Code: https://itpanther.com/liferayGrafana - Learn to do Analytics with Grafana: https://itpanther.com/grafanaRedis - Learn World's Fastest Database: https://itpanther.com/redisBMC Control-M for Beginners: https://itpanther.com/controlmIn This video we are going to learn about installing Grafana on a Windows Operating System. Install on Windows | Grafana documentation Its mounted to /var/lib/grafana within the container, where Grafana stores all its generated data. HTTPS Do this also for the default.ini file. But the Grafana config file cant read it. select environment variables, on variables of user select the row "path", select the button edit. You need to mount a Docker volume to store your persistent data and bind a host port so you can access the service. Click I accept the agreement & Next > Next > Next > Next > Install > Uncheck One-time $10 donation to Windows OpenSSL > Finish. The solution - how to convert the .crt and .key files to .pem files: The Grafana service requires the .crt certificate file and the .key file to be converted to .pem file type. To run Grafana, open your browser and go to the Grafana port (http://localhost:3000/ is default) and then follow the instructions in Getting Started. Making it an article seemed to be the less appropriate option. Grafana Windows Version how to implement HTTPS and ldaps LDAPS I exported in DER 509x root ca certificate from server with grafana and I converted it to pem and then renamed it to crt.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. Click on that and select Import, On the next window, simply enter the dashboard ID in the corresponding field. Read more about the configuration options. This is my first error: Click on the + sign then click on Dashboard. Good article. "Windows Node" Grafana dashboard contains many panels . Explore logs by quickly searching or streaming them live. All you have to do: Go to link: https://grafana.com/grafana/download?platform=windows Minimum recommended CPU: 1. Next use the Grafana CLI to install the Cloudflare plugin. PromQL which is a very powerful querying language. A guide to Grafana installation on Windows Server 2022 with Openssl certificate & key in https configuration: Download OpenSSL for Windows through third party: http://slproweb.com/products.html with the direct download link as http://slproweb.com/download/Win64OpenSSL-3_0_7.msi. Next return to the homepage and click Create your first dashboard. Choose your preferred visualization type and then use the query pane to select the appropriate metrics from your data. Is it too difficult to use certificates from CA server with Linux? The following operating systems are supported for Grafana installation: Installation of Grafana on other operating systems is possible, but it is neither recommended nor supported. How to configure https for Grafana on Windows Server 2022? Then add your organization, and the API token registered to your username. :::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::::: The error after configuring Grafana's custom.ini file to use a supplied .crt and .key file: The error - "Windows Could not start the Grafana service on Local Computer.". The New Outlook Is Opening Up to More People, Windows 11 Feature Updates Are Speeding Up, E-Win Champion Fabric Gaming Chair Review, Amazon Echo Dot With Clock (5th-gen) Review, Grelife 24in Oscillating Space Heater Review: Comfort and Functionality Combined, VCK Dual Filter Air Purifier Review: Affordable and Practical for Home or Office, LatticeWork Amber X Personal Cloud Storage Review: Backups Made Easy, Neat Bumblebee II Review: It's Good, It's Affordable, and It's Usually On Sale, Grafana is a leading observability platform, How to Win $2000 By Learning to Code a Rocket League Bot, How to Fix Your Connection Is Not Private Errors, How to Watch UFC 285 Jones vs. Gane Live Online, 2023 LifeSavvy Media. Note: You can replace the default configuration file with a new file and before doing this, ensure you make a backup of this file, so when you run into configuration issues, etc in the new file, then you can revert to it. Copy conf/sample.ini to a file named conf/custom.ini and change the service using that tool. I went with the default of full installation. WMI Exporter is an exporter utilized for windows servers to collects metrics like CPU usage, memory, and Disk usage. requires special privileges on Windows. Grafana Labs uses cookies for the normal operation of this website. Move to the folder where you want to store your certifacte and key Once the services are identified and the targets are ready then we can pull metrics from it and can scrape the target. Firstly I will give you more details about my environment: If a law is new but its interpretation is vague, can the courts directly ask the drafters the intent and official interpretation of their law? Using the below command we can download Prometheus, here we are downloading Prometheus 2.32.1 version, you use the above link to download specific version. Find centralized, trusted content and collaborate around the technologies you use most. upon entering the default password, you will be prompted to change your password. open control panel. Storage in Prometheus server has a local on disk storage. And the Grafana server is installed in Microsoft Windows Server 2019. This might differ with regards to how many you have created. how to Install Grafana on Windows and Run as a Service We can export the data of the end point using node exporters. PEM format is required for the Grafana and you should to check used system/documentation how you can you obtain if from the system, which you are using. This is a known issue; for more information, see issue #13399. Make it easy to read for users, pls. this time. Next will be to accept the terms for the License Agreement then choose the features to install. Now the installation of Grafana is complete and if the service is running correctly, you should be able to fire-up Grafana on the server any of the following below. Read Upgrading Grafana for tips and guidance on updating an existing installation. With stunnel in two sides in the Microsoft Windows Server 2019 and in the Domain controller? We can save the dashboard and can even share with our team members which is one of the main advantage of Grafana. If you do not have them, kindly navigate to InfluxDB Installation and Telegraf Installation to see how to do it. This could be an internal Windows error or an internal service error. Press the Add your first data source button on the homepage to connect a new source; select the provider type on the following screen, then fill in the details so Grafana can access your data. 7:Install Prometheus and Grafana on Windows -WMI Exporter - YouTube IP Many Grafana installations require plugins that add extra data sources or provide pre-built dashboard panels. Windows could not start the Grafana service on Local Computer after uncommenting settings in the Grafana configuration file "custom.ini" under "Server" options. format from the Windows Server 2019. Email update@grafana.com for help. For this installation, its conf folder is located atC:\Program Files\GrafanaLabs\grafanaas an example. Sign up to Skillshare using this link and get one month free membership. Start Grafana by executing grafana-server.exe, located in the bin directory, preferably from the command line. But without success. You confirm that its possible to use Windows version of Grafana with HTTPS and LDAPS under Microsoft environment? First you will need to have a running version of Grafana . You can either download the Windows installer package or a standalone Windows binary file. Install Grafana | Grafana documentation Edit custom.ini and uncomment the http_port It will bring a success non-active dialog to show the number of buckets in your Influx DB. Download and Install Grafana on Windows | Setup Grafana Dashboards - YouTube 0:00 4:58 Download and Install Grafana on Windows | Setup Grafana Dashboards Tech Guru Tech 3.48K. The scenario is:
Deities Associated With Insects,
Jay Johnston Conservative,
Car Accident In Canandaigua, Ny Today,
Jetblue Pilot Uniforms,
Flight Lieutenant Raaf,
Articles H
how to install grafana on windows More Stories